This is the most common type of professional sales invoice small businesses use to request payment from their customers. The seller usually gives a sales invoice to the buyer during a transaction. It is used as a record of the purchase containing information on prices, quantities, discounts, what is a sales invoice and any other relevant information. In addition, it will include information on payments that have been received and any which are yet to be made. Furthermore, it also allows to issue and manage customer’s invoices. A sales invoice includes contact information for both you and your customer.
